NFRC rating system and labeling system for energy performance windows doors, skylights and attachment products

The National Fenestration Rating Council is an organization for non-profits that provides a uniform and independent labeling system for assessing the energy efficiency of doors and windows skylights, windows, and other products for attachment. This label allows consumers to make informed decisions about energy efficient products.

These energy ratings are in addition to other NFRC labels , such as structural performance and air quality ratings. These ratings can be used to determine the energy efficiency of a building.

Apart from determining the insulation value of the window, ratings also measure the performance of the sealants, weatherstripping and insulation glass units. They also measure the light transmission of the visible light.

NFRC labels are available for many regions and can provide more information about a product other than the R-value or U-factor. They provide ratings for Solar Heat Gain and Visible Light Transmittance, Solar Heat Gain Coefficient, Condensation Resistance, Air Leakage and other parameters.

The NFRC website provides comprehensive information on its certification process. You can download fact sheets about NFRC and find out more about the council.

The NFRC-certified products have been independently tested and certified by a third-party. The certification process includes an independent review of product manufacturing, design, and participation in the NFRC rating system and labeling system.

Many companies in the field of fenestration are members of the NFRC. The NFRC was established in response to the energy crisis of the 1970s. Today, NFRC is composed of manufacturers, government agencies researchers, suppliers, and other manufacturers. The NFRC's ratings are used in the major energy efficiency programs.
